What’s the Big Idea Behind a CHNA?

Let’s break it down. A Community Health Needs Assessment is a structured way to collect and analyze data on the health status of a specific population. Sounds straightforward, right? But there’s so much more happening behind the scenes. It’s about engaging with community members—not just sending out surveys and calling it a day, but truly connecting. You know what I mean? This can be through surveys, focus groups, or public forums, where voices are not just heard but celebrated.

Imagine attending a community forum where your ideas about health needs are welcomed. You share your perspective on access to mental health services or the need for more recreational areas to encourage physical activity. This kind of interaction helps map the community's health landscape, revealing gaps and setting priorities for action.

Why Is the CHNA a Game Changer?

Let’s get real for a moment. The CHNA isn’t just another checkbox in a bureaucratic checklist. It serves several key purposes that are crucial for improving health outcomes.

  1. Identifying Gaps in Health Services: Think about it—how many times have you noticed gaps in available health services? The CHNA makes it easier to spot areas where health services are lacking, helping stakeholders understand where to focus their energies.

  2. Prioritizing Interventions: Not all health issues are created equal, and communities often have to prioritize interventions based on needs. This assessment provides a clear picture of what’s urgent and where resources can make the most impact. Sometimes, it might mean stepping up efforts in mental health versus physical health, depending on community feedback. It’s all about context.

  3. Resource Allocation: Resources are finite, and every dollar counts. By systematically evaluating needs, a community can allocate funds effectively, ensuring that they’re not just throwing money at random initiatives but are instead making smart choices that resonate with the actual needs on the ground.

  4. Fostering Collaboration: Collaboration is key! CHNAs encourage teamwork among various stakeholders like public health agencies, hospitals, and local organizations. Imagine if rather than working in silos, everyone rallies together under a common mission to improve community health. It’s a powerful way to unify efforts, share information, and tackle health challenges collaboratively.

Beyond the CHNA: What About Other Tools?

Now, I hear you—there are other methods out there. Tools like Health Impact Assessments and Surveillance Data Analysis also play important roles. Health Impact Assessments focus on specific projects and their potential health effects, while Surveillance Data Analysis looks at specific health indicators over time. Useful? Absolutely. But they don’t provide that holistic perspective that a CHNA does.

Moreover, let’s not forget Patient Satisfaction Surveys. These are valuable for gauging care experiences. However, they largely zoom in on individual experiences rather than community-wide health needs. That’s where the CHNA really shines—by offering a comprehensive view of community health in all its complexity.

The Road Ahead: Making Change Happen

At the end of the day, the goal of performing a Community Health Needs Assessment is to catalyze change. But how does that happen? Well, it’s all about action. Stakeholders can use the findings to create targeted strategies that resonate with community needs.

Maybe the assessment reveals a pressing need for mental health support for youth. Armed with that knowledge, local agencies can develop tailored programs aimed at providing counseling services in schools or engaging community leaders in awareness campaigns.
